Chapter 13: An Amazing Thing
8 Years Later...
"Rory! Come on. We're gonna be late." Logan called up the stairs.
"I'm coming." she said as she made her way down the stairs of the penthouse they shared in New York. "Ok, lets go." she said, grabbing his hand and pulling him out the door.
"So, you ready for this?" he asked once they got into the car.
"Am I ready to see Finn and Paris get married? No way. I mean, I know they love each other, but I never expected Finn to actually get married. Ever."
"I know what you mean." he said as he continued to drive to the hall where Finn and Paris were getting married.
"Love!" Finn slurred. "Come, dance with me, the newly married man."
Finn and Paris had a nice ceremony and were now married. "Sure Finn, let's dance." Rory said.
"Hey, keep your hands where I can see them." Logan joked. "I don't want them all over my wife."
"I'll behave." Finn said.
"You better." Paris said jokingly.
"Congratulations Finn." Rory said, once they were dancing.
"Thanks love." he said. "And I think congratulations are in order for you too." he said, smiling.
"Finn, what are you talking about."
"Baby Huntzberger." he whispered with a smirk.
"Finn! How did you find out about that?" she hissed.
"Paris talks in her sleep."
"Great." Rory said with a sigh.
"I swear I haven't said anything to anyone."
"Hey, Rory!" Colin said, coming up to give her a hug. "I heard the news! Congrats on the baby."
"Well, except Colin." Finn said.
"Finn, you better not have told Logan."
"He doesn't know?" Colin asked.
"No. I'm going to tell him tonight."
"So who exactly knows?" Colin asked.
Flashback
"I can't believe this." Rory muttered as she paced the bathroom floor.
"It'll be ok Ror."
"Steph! How will it be ok? This is so unexpected! We didn't plan this."
"Rory, come on. It's not like your in college. You're married, and you have a job. God knows you and Logan have plenty of money, so stop worrying." Paris said, trying to calm her.
"What if he freaks out?"
"He won't." Steph said.
"What if he does?"
"He won't." Paris said, a little more forcefully.
"How can you be so sure?"
"He just won't, ok?" Steph exclaimed. "We've all know Huntz since we were babies. He over reacts sometimes, but he's not going to freak out Rory. Calm down."
Rory took a deep breath. "Ok. I'll be calm." She was quiet for a minute. "Oh my God, I'm having a baby." she said, breaking her calm state and becoming completely terrified again.
End Flashback
"Just Paris and Steph. Well, now the two of you as well."
"So, you're definitely telling him tonight?" Finn asked.
"Yes."
"Good, because he needs to know." Colin said.
"Ace, are you ok?" Logan asked as he watched his wife pace in the bedroom.
"Fine." she said, stopping and looking up at him. He was standing in the doorway with two cups of coffee in his hand. He offered her one and she accepted it, but didn't drink any. She set it on the end table next to the bed and paced a little more.
"Are you sure? You didn't drink any of your coffee."
"I'm pregnant." she said quickly. She silently cursed herself. She wanted to build it up a little, and here she blurted it out.
"What?" he asked.
"I'm pregnant." she said again, a little slower.
"What?" he asked again.
"We're having a baby."
"Say it again."
"We're having a baby."
"One more time." he said with a small smirk as he placed his hands on her hips and brought her closer.
"Logan..."
"Ace..." he mimicked.
"Logan, we're having a baby."
He smiled before kissing her deeply. "This is great."
"You're happy?"
"Why wouldn't I be?" he asked.
"I don't know. This is kind of a scary thing."
"But it's also an amazing thing."
Rory smiled. "You know what? It is." she said before kissing him.
She moved out of his grip and went to get the coffee she had placed on the end table and placed it next to her lips.
"No way." he said before she could take a sip. He grabbed it from her and started for the kitchen.
"Logan!" she called.
"No Ace. Our baby is not going to have two heads!"
"But then there's more to love!"
"No way."
"Logan." she whined as she followed him to the kitchen. His faint laughter was heard as she got closer. She was smiling the whole time. He was just looking out for her. And she loved him for that.
